Salut à tous,
Je suis en train de chercher la fonction, dans la librairie xbee.h, qui permet de récupérer, sur l'arduino l'adresse source, au format 64Bits à la réception d'une trame.
J'ai cherché sur : http://xbee-arduino.googlecode.com/svn-history/r7/trunk/docs/api/class_x_bee_response.html#72e5b863c14a9ec0a4f1cdeba5f24e58
Mais j'ai rien trouvé, j'ai l'impression que c'est pas possible. A part le getData(n) ... J'ai peux être des problèmes de vu
Voila mon code source très simple :
xbee.readPacket();
Serial.println("Lecture xbee");
// 2. Now, to check if a packet was received:
if (xbee.getResponse().isAvailable())
{
if (xbee.getResponse().getApiId() == ZB_RX_RESPONSE)
{
xbee.getResponse().getZBRxResponse(zbRx);
// Recupération de id client pour renvoie par la suite
num_client=zbRx.getData(0);
}
}